FOX 4 News Crime Files: Week of September 15
SUMMARY: In Downtown Dallas, a man named Antonio Banks was arrested for a brutal, seemingly unprovoked attack on a woman, following her for several blocks before striking her with a blunt object, resulting in severe injuries. Surveillance footage led police to identify him. Banks, who was on parole at the time, has been charged with aggravated assault. In a separate incident, Fort Worth Officer William Martin faces charges of aggravated assault after allegedly shooting an unarmed driver following a traffic dispute. Additionally, Kevin Sheffield was sentenced to 50 years for two random murders, and a suspected drunk driver caused a crash resulting in a woman’s death.

Houston police investigating deadly shooting involving 2 men on south side
SUMMARY: During a recent incident at a small apartment complex in Houston, one man, estimated to be 18 to 25 years old, was fatally shot, while another man was critically injured. The shootings occurred near Tier Wester and McGregor on Friday night. Police believe the two incidents are connected, as they occurred at the same complex, which is largely vacant. Witnesses directed officers to the scene, where the deceased was found with a mask and a pistol. Investigators are seeking information and video evidence to determine a motive, as they work to track down witnesses in the area.

Suspect arrested after being charged with shooting girlfriend
SUMMARY: A family mourns the tragic loss of 24-year-old Joselyn Espinosa, who was shot and killed by her boyfriend, 19-year-old Francisco Ooa, during an argument outside a motel. The incident occurred early Sunday morning when Ooa, after being locked out of his truck, allegedly fired his gun, fatally injuring Joselyn. Although he drove her to the hospital, she succumbed to her injuries within hours. Joselyn leaves behind a seven-year-old daughter, and her family is calling for justice while highlighting the dangers of domestic violence, urging others to seek help. Ooa has turned himself in and faces a manslaughter charge.

Texas oil and gas jobs show three months of jobs growth | Texas
SUMMARY: Texas experienced notable job growth in August, particularly in the upstream oil and natural gas sector, which added 1,000 jobs, marking three consecutive months of gains. Since September 2020, the industry has added 37,400 jobs, reflecting sustained demand for energy resources. Texas Oil & Gas Association president Todd Staples highlighted the state‘s role in meeting energy needs globally. August data shows 11,823 active job postings in the industry, averaging salaries of $124,000. The sector also contributed $543 million in oil production taxes and $80 million in natural gas taxes, funding various public services.
